A clean and well-maintained office is essential for a productive work environment. While most businesses prioritize surface cleaning, air ducts often go unnoticed. Booking professional air duct cleaning services for your office is a crucial step in ensuring improved air quality, HVAC efficiency, and overall employee well-being.
Over time, dust, dirt, pet dander, pollen, and even mold can accumulate within the air ducts of an office building. These contaminants circulate through the air and can cause allergies, respiratory problems, and fatigue among employees. Poor air quality affects focus and efficiency, leading to an overall decrease in workplace productivity. Regular air duct cleaning eliminates these pollutants, providing fresh and breathable air for employees and clients alike.
A clogged HVAC system works harder to push air through blocked vents, consuming more energy and leading to higher electricity costs. Additionally, dust buildup can damage HVAC components, resulting in expensive repairs or system failure. By scheduling professional air duct cleaning, businesses can optimize airflow, reduce energy consumption, and extend the life of their heating and cooling systems. A clean system also ensures consistent indoor temperatures, making the office environment more comfortable.
Booking an air duct cleaning service is easy. Start by researching companies with strong customer reviews and industry credentials. Reputable professionals use advanced equipment, such as HEPA-filtered vacuums and antimicrobial treatments, to remove dust, mold, and bacteria from the ducts. A thorough cleaning process includes inspecting ductwork, eliminating contaminants, and sanitizing air vents to prevent future buildup.
Most offices should schedule air duct cleaning every 3 to 5 years. However, offices in high-traffic areas or regions with high pollution levels may require more frequent cleanings. Regular maintenance ensures a healthier workspace, reducing sick days among employees and creating a more pleasant working environment.
